Home window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new, modern units that improve the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. This process typically includes measuring window openings, selecting appropriate window styles, and securely installing the new units to ensure proper operation and sealing. These services can be customized to match the architectural style of the home and the specific needs of the homeowner, whether that means upgrading for better insulation, enhanced security, or a fresh aesthetic.

Replacing windows can help address a range of common problems homeowners face. Older windows may have drafts, leaks, or difficulty opening and closing, which can lead to higher energy bills and reduced comfort inside the home. Cracked or broken glass can also pose safety concerns, while outdated frames may be prone to rot or damage. Upgrading to new windows can eliminate these issues, providing a more secure, energy-efficient, and visually appealing solution that enhances the overall value of the property.

The overview below groups typical Home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Zionsville,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window replacements, such as single-pane units or small sizes,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the window type and installation specifics.

Standard Replacements - Replacing standard-sized double-pane windows usually costs between $600-$1,200 per window.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all into this typical range.

Large or Custom Windows - Larger, custom, or specialty windows can range from $1,200-$3,000 each, with some high-end or complex installations reaching $4,000+ in rare cases. Fewer projects push into these higher tiers, which are often for unique or premium window styles.

Full Home Window Replacement - When replacing all windows in a home, costs often range from $10,000-$25,000 or more, depending on the number and type of windows. Many projects fall into the mid-range, with larger or more elaborate homes reaching higher budgets.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ing home windows? Replacing windows can improve energy efficiency, enhance curb appeal, and increase indoor comfort by reducing drafts and heat loss.

How do I know if my home needs window replacement? Signs include difficulty opening or closing windows, visible damage or rot, and increased energy bills due to poor insulation.

What types of windows are available for replacement? There are various options including double-hung, casement, picture, and sliding windows, each offering different styles and functionalities.

Can local contractors help with custom window sizes? Yes, experienced service providers can often accommodate custom measurements to ensure a perfect fit for any home.

What should I consider when choosing window styles? Consider factors like ventilation, light, aesthetic preferences, and the architectural style of the home to select suitable window designs.
